We learn what it takes to be a semitruck driver
Published atIDAHO FALLS — The EastIdahoNews.com team is highlighting different jobs in our area, and today, we’re Workin’ It at Western Transport in Idaho Falls.
Truck drivers at Western Transport haul items all over the country and work to make sure they’re safe on the road.
But what does it take to be a truck driver? We spent a few hours with Don Best, the Western Transport Safety Director, and he gave us a rundown on how to be a driver.
